Dixon Named Warrior Offensive Player of the Week

April 29, 2013 - Major League Lacrosse (MLL)
Chesapeake Bayhawks News Release


ANNAPOLIS, MD - Chesapeake Bayhawks midfielder Kyle Dixon was named the Warrior Offensive Player of the Week according to Major League Lacrosse (MLL).

Dixon led the Bayhawks to a 17-14 win over the Rochester Rattlers Saturday night, highlighted by three two-point goals. This matches the MLL record book for two-point goals in a game, last set by Dixon himself in May of 2012. He also raised his individual career record for two-point goals, hitting 50, furthering the distance from runner-up Roy Colsey who has 33.

"When an elite player comes back in shape, great things happen," head coach Dave Cottle said. "Dixon has prepared himself to have a great season. He put on a shooting show in Florida and scored from all angles which is a testament to his off-season preparation."

Two of Dixon's two-point goals came in the first quarter, as well as an assist to Ben Hunt. His third goal came in the second quarter, accumulating all seven of his points in the first half of the game. Dixon was named Player of the Game, and will look to continue his success this weekend at home against the New York Lizards.
